For those who have express an interest in viewing the political model in a new light, I give you the Nolan Chart. This chart is used to replace the traditional left-right wing model to provide a better understanding of the differences between political parties and ideologies. STANDARD POLITICAL CHART left right |--------------------------------------------------------| 1 2 3 4 5 (no home for #6) ************************************************************* THE NOLAN CHART % 100 - | 7 S | O | 6 C 75 - I | A | 3 L | 50 - 2 F | R | 4 E | E 25 - D | 1 5 O | M | 0 -----------|-----------|---------|---------| 0 25 50 75 100 % ECONOMIC FREEDOM Key: 1) communist 2) social democrat 3) liberal 4) conservative 5) fascist 6) libertarian 7) anarchist SOCIAL FREEDOMS, often called 'civil liberties', consists of things like censorship, gun control, sexual conduct, freedom of communication, drug legalization, tolerance of behavioural diversity. ECONOMIC FREEDOMS consists of things like low taxation, unregulated free market economy. Tolerance of economic diversity. The chart can be further divided into the 'four continents' of the political world: conservative, interventionist, liberal and libertarian. THE NOLAN CHART % 100 - | | | S | | O | | C 75 - LIBERAL | LIBERTARIAN I | | A | | L | | 50 ------------------------|-------------------- F | | R | | E | | E 25 - INTERVENTIONIST | CONSERVATIVE D | | O | | M | | 0 -----------|-----------|---------|---------| 0 25 50 75 100 % ECONOMIC FREEDOM * Liberals generally advocate economic encroachment and civil liberty. * Conservatives generally advocate economic liberty and civil encoachment. * Interventionists advocate both economic and civil encoachment. * Libertarians advocate both economic and civil liberty.
